Water Hardness in Corwen (LL21)
The water in postcode district LL21 is classified as slightly hard with a hardness level of 68 ppm (parts per million) calcium carbonate. This is 139 ppm below the UK national average of 207 ppm.
Your water is supplied by Welsh Water (Dwr Cymru), which serves the Wales region. Welsh Water (Dwr Cymru) draws water from sources that naturally contain dissolved minerals, primarily calcium and magnesium compounds.
What Does Slightly Hard Water Mean for Your Home?
- ~ Minor limescale may appear in kettles over time
- ~ Soap lathers reasonably well
- ~ Appliances generally unaffected
- ~ Good balance of mineral taste
